    The Core i9-7920X is manufactured by Intel. It was released in 10 September 2017 (8 years ago). It is based on the Skylake (server) (2017−2018) architecture. It features 12 cores and 24 threads. Base frequency is 2.9 GHz, with boost up to 4.4 GHz. L3 cache: 16.5 MB (total). L2 cache: 1 MB (per core). Built on 14 nm process technology. Socket: LGA2066. Thermal design power (TDP): 140 Watt. Memory support: DDR4-2666. Passmark benchmark score: 23,508 points. Launch price was $1,199.

    AMD

    Ryzen 9 PRO 6950H

    The Ryzen 9 PRO 6950H is manufactured by AMD. It was released in 19 April 2022 (3 years ago). It is based on the Rembrandt-H (Zen 3+) (2022) architecture. It features 8 cores and 16 threads. Base frequency is 3.3 GHz, with boost up to 4.9 GHz. L3 cache: 16 MB (total). L2 cache: 512K (per core). Built on 6 nm process technology. Socket: FP7. Thermal design power (TDP): 45 Watt. Memory support: DDR5. Passmark benchmark score: 23,781 points. Launch price was $299.

    Processing Power

    The Core i9-7920X packs 12 cores / 24 threads, while the Ryzen 9 PRO 6950H offers 8 cores / 16 threads — the Core i9-7920X has 4 more cores. Boost clocks reach 4.4 GHz on the Core i9-7920X versus 4.9 GHz on the Ryzen 9 PRO 6950H — a 10.8% clock advantage for the Ryzen 9 PRO 6950H (base: 2.9 GHz vs 3.3 GHz). The Core i9-7920X uses the Skylake (server) (2017−2018) architecture (14 nm), while the Ryzen 9 PRO 6950H uses Rembrandt-H (Zen 3+) (2022) (6 nm). In PassMark, the Core i9-7920X scores 23,508 against the Ryzen 9 PRO 6950H's 23,781 — a 1.2% lead for the Ryzen 9 PRO 6950H. L3 cache: 16.5 MB (total) on the Core i9-7920X vs 16 MB (total) on the Ryzen 9 PRO 6950H.
